Before transferring to OSU, have the TCC Registrar send an official transcript to the OSU Admissions Office with any degrees earned noted on the transcript. If you have not completed the requirements for an associate degree, talk with your OSU Academic Advisor about Reverse Transfer options to use OSU coursework to complete your TCC associate degree.

ACCT 3113 – Intermediate Accounting II MGMT 4513 – Strategic Management ACCT 4503 – Auditing and Assurance Services ACCT 3013 – Federal Income Taxation MSIS 4123 – Information Assurance Management ACCT 4133 – Advanced Accounting BCOM 3113 – Written Communication 3 hours from 9 hour list in major (See Note A) 3 hours from 9 hour list in major (See Note A) 3 hours from 9 hour list in major (See Note A) Semester Credit Hours at OSU: 15 Semester Credit Hours at OSU: 15 This plan is only one example of how a student may successfully complete degree requirements in four years. Students are responsible for completing the requirements as given in the official degree requirements sheet.

Note A: Can be any course from the list: ACCT 4033, 4553, 4763, 4930, ECON 3023, 3113, 3313, FIN 4113, 4213, 4223, 4333, 4763, 4843, LSB 4323, 4523, 4633, MSIS 2203, 3333, 4113, 4253, 4273, MKTG 4773, or STAT 3013. The TCC substitutions and equivalencies also apply to these options under Accounting: External Reporting, Control and Auditing and Internal Reporting, Control and Auditing.
